Problem
Existing clamping systems for aligning and securing pins in imaging systems and other apparatuses often experience jamming issues due to the size mismatch between the pin and the clamp, which can lead to inaccurate alignment and require additional tools for alignment.
Innovation Solution
The use of rotatable clamping elements with a biasing device, such as a spring, that maintains a large opening relative to the pin's diameter, allowing for self-alignment and direct contact with the pin, reducing jamming and the need for external alignment tools.

Function Achieved in This Case
This solution provides accurate alignment and reduces jamming by allowing the clamping elements to rotate and adjust to the pin's position, ensuring precise contact and minimizing the likelihood of jamming during alignment and removal processes.
Implementation Method 1
A biasing device, such as a spring, can couple one of the clamping elements to the other clamping element. The biasing device can bias the clamping elements in a non-clamping relationship
